The Symbolism of Owls in Japanese Culture: Owls hold a special place in Japanese culture and traditional folklore. Considered a symbol of wisdom, luck, and protection, they are believed to bring good fortune and ward off evil spirits. In Japanese folklore, some stories even depict owls as messengers of the gods. These cultural beliefs have contributed to the rise in popularity of owl toys and collectibles in Japan. 2. Types of Owl Toys and Collectibles: Japanese owl toys and collectibles come in various forms, catering to diverse tastes and preferences. Here are a few popular types you might come across: a. Plush Toys: Soft, huggable owl plush toys make excellent companions for both children and adults. They often feature intricate detailing, including different owl species, vibrant colors, and adorable expressions. b. Figurines and Statues: Owl figurines and statues are highly sought-after by collectors worldwide. Made from materials like resin, porcelain, or wood, they capture the intricate anatomy and beauty of owls. Some figurines may also depict owls wearing traditional Japanese attire, adding an extra touch of culture. c. Stationery and Accessories: Owls can also be found on a variety of stationery items, including pens, journals, stickers, and keychains. These owl-themed accessories allow enthusiasts to express their love for these majestic creatures in their day-to-day lives. d. Homeware and Dcor: Owls have also made their way into Japanese home dcor. From cute owl-shaped tea sets and ceramics to intricately carved owl-themed artwork, there are countless ways to incorporate owls into your home. 3. Where to Find Owl Toys and Collectibles: Japan is a treasure trove for owl enthusiasts, offering a wide range of stores dedicated to owl-themed merchandise. Here are a few places to start your hunt for owl toys and collectibles: a. Tsukiji Fish Market in Tokyo: This bustling market is not only a seafood paradise but also home to several stores specializing in unique and quirky goods, including owl-themed items. b. Owl Cafs: Yes, you heard it right. Japan is famous for its animal cafs, and owl cafs are no exception. These cafs provide visitors with the opportunity to interact with live owls while enjoying a cup of coffee. Some cafs also sell owl-related merchandise for you to take home. c. Harajuku and Akihabara in Tokyo: These vibrant districts are known for their abundance of trendy and niche stores. You are likely to find owl toys and collectibles in shops devoted to kawaii (cute) culture and anime/manga. d. Online Marketplaces: If you are unable to visit Japan, several websites offer a vast selection of Japanese owl toys and collectibles, making them easily accessible to fans worldwide.
